Microphone Preamps (XLR Preamplifiers)
Microphone preamps use special circuits to amplify low signal levels up to the standard operating level of your recording equipment. Preamps prepare your microphone signal for processing by various recording devices. Many computer audio interfaces and systems have internalized preamplifier circuits, but you can also use a dedicated external preamp. Microphone signals are usually below nominal operating levels, so mics benefit considerably from the added gain provided by preamps.
Benefits of Using a Microphone Preamp
A dedicated external microphone preamp can boost the sound quality of your recordings considerably. You can add high levels of gain while maintaining crystal clear sound. Preamps can reduce noise levels, helping you achieve a clean, professional sound. Depending on the type of preamp you choose, you can customize the sound of your vocal recording if you need vintage or distorted sound.
Types of Microphone Preamps
Before deciding on your mic preamp take a look at the different types available, to ensure you choose the right one for your needs.
Stereo Tube Preamps
Tube preamps feature glass tubes, and use transformers to help voltage drive your sound. They offer a richer midrange, greater texture, and excellent realism.
Solid-State Preamps
Solid-state preamps use transistors to boost your mic signal to a voltage level that your amps can magnify, offering greater detail and faster sound.
Multichannel Preamps
While single and dual-channel preamps are ideal for recording with one or two mics at a time, multichannel preamps are necessary if you're building a professional studio, as they enable you to record with many mics at the same time.
Using Preamps for Instruments
You can use preamps for a variety of musical instruments. Guitar preamps often take the form of pedals, and can be used to achieve different EQ points and adjust your pre-gain tone. Using a preamp pedal also provides you with consistency if you switch guitars or travel from venue to venue.
If you like to play vinyl records, you can also use a preamp to significantly boost the sound quality of your turntable. Turntable preamps can increase sound levels for a more accurate and detailed representation of your favorite music.
